Abstract :
Cutter as an essential manufacturing tool, its information model is widely used in varied information systems in manufacturing. In order to achieve the integration in different information systems and solve the problem that cutter information model is difficult to reflect model information diversity in system integration process, a model based on heterogeneous data is given. A three-layer separation model built method is applied to initialize the cutter information model. To solve the defects of common identification method, cutter information identification method based on GUID is put forward. This method ensures the uniqueness of cutter information in each integration system and provides good conditions to achieve the unified integrated platform.
